Omayra Sanchez and the Nevado del Ruiz Tragedy
According to the United States Geological Survey, On November 13th, 1985, the mighty Nevado del Ruiz volcano erupted, shattering the lives of many people. Melting of the mountaintop snows as a result of the incredible heat, the eruption caused far more problems than the typical rain of ash and fire. The melted snow and ice caused the nearby Azufrado, and Gauli rivers to overflow and consume nearby settlements. Hardest hit was the small town of Armero, where three quarters of its population, 23,000 out of 28,700, died in the flood. (Nevado del Ruiz) Most tragic of these many deaths was that of Omayra Sanchez, a thirteen year old girl trapped in the mud following the eruption. Try as they might, the locals could not free the young girl from her prison of filth. Three days after the eruption, on November 16th, Omayra Sanchez passed away from dehydration and fatigue. (Cibertol) Eyewitnesses report that she met her death with bravery, free of fear. For this, she has become the symbol of the Armero tragedy, and rightfully so. One can only admire her courage in the face of death.
